Welcome to Healthy Connections, your destination for quality healthcare across the state of Arkansas. For over 25 years, we have been steadfast in our commitment to providing exceptional medical, dental, and behavioral health services to the diverse communities we proudly serve.
As premier health clinics in Arkansas, we are a Federally-Qualified Health Center (FQHC) that embraces a patient-centric approach. Our services extend beyond conventional healthcare; we are dedicated to ensuring access to quality care for all, with a focus on inclusivity and community engagement.
Comprehensive Health Services Across Arkansas At Healthy Connections, we operate as health clinics across Arkansas, offering a wide range of medical, dental, and behavioral health services. Our medical clinics are equipped to handle various healthcare needs, from routine check-ups to specialized care. Our dental clinics provide comprehensive dental services, promoting oral health and well-being. Additionally, our behavioral health clinics cater to the mental health needs of our community, fostering emotional wellness.
Accepting Medicaid and Medicare, Supporting Our Communities As Medicaid and Medicare accepted clinics in Arkansas, we are committed to removing barriers to healthcare access. Our goal is to ensure that everyone in our community, regardless of financial circumstances, can receive the care they need. We also operate on a sliding fee scale, providing affordable healthcare to those without insurance. Our dedication to accessibility is further underscored by our acceptance of ArKids 1st, making us a reliable choice for families seeking pediatric care.
Diversity and Inclusivity in Healthcare Healthy Connections takes pride in being part of Arkansas community health centers that prioritize diversity and inclusivity. Our healthcare team is culturally competent, ensuring that every patient receives personalized and respectful care. We embrace the diversity of our community and strive to make healthcare accessible to everyone.

About the RoleThe Practice Manager plays a pivotal role in overseeing the daily operations of a healthcare practice to ensure efficient, high-quality patient care and optimal business performance. This position requires strategic leadership to manage staff, coordinate administrative functions, and implement policies that align with regulatory standards and organizational goals. The Practice Manager is responsible for fostering a collaborative environment that supports clinical teams and enhances patient satisfaction. They will analyze financial data, manage budgets, and drive initiatives to improve operational workflows and resource utilization. Ultimately, the role ensures the practice operates smoothly, complies with healthcare regulations, and delivers exceptional service to patients and stakeholders.
Minimum Qualifications- Minimum of 3 years of experience in healthcare practice management or a similar administrative role.
- Strong knowledge of healthcare regulations, compliance standards, and medical billing processes.
- Proficiency with electronic health record (EHR) systems and practice management software.
- Excellent communication, leadership, and organizational skills.
- Bachelor's degree in Healthcare Administration, Business Administration, or a related field preferred.
- Certification such as Certified Medical Practice Executive (CMPE) or Fellow of the American College of Medical Practice Executives (FACMPE).
- Experience managing multi-specialty practices or larger healthcare organizations.
- Familiarity with quality improvement methodologies and patient experience enhancement strategies.
- Advanced financial management skills including budgeting, forecasting, and revenue cycle management.
- Manage day-to-day operations of the healthcare practice, including scheduling, staffing, and patient flow coordination.
- Lead, mentor, and evaluate administrative and clinical staff to promote a positive and productive work environment.
- Develop and implement policies and procedures to ensure compliance with healthcare laws, regulations, and accreditation standards.
- Oversee financial management activities such as budgeting, billing, and expense control to maintain fiscal responsibility.
- Collaborate with healthcare providers to optimize patient care delivery and address operational challenges.
- Coordinate with external vendors, insurance companies, and regulatory bodies as needed.
- Analyze practice performance metrics and prepare reports to inform strategic decision-making.
- Drive continuous improvement initiatives to enhance efficiency, patient satisfaction, and staff engagement.
The Practice Manager utilizes leadership and communication skills daily to effectively coordinate between clinical staff, administrative teams, and external partners, ensuring smooth operations and high morale. Analytical skills are essential for interpreting financial reports and operational data to make informed decisions that improve practice performance. Proficiency with EHR and practice management software enables efficient scheduling, billing, and compliance tracking. Problem-solving skills are applied to address challenges related to patient care delivery and regulatory adherence. Additionally, strategic planning and organizational skills support the implementation of policies and initiatives that drive continuous improvement and sustainable growth.
